Understanding the Ingredients
To create the perfect Zesty Blueberry Lemon Dream Bars, it’s crucial to understand the role each ingredient plays in achieving that ideal flavor and texture. Let’s break down the essential components of both the crust and the filling.
The Crust Ingredients
1. All-Purpose Flour: This versatile ingredient forms the base of the crust. All-purpose flour provides the necessary structure and stability, allowing the crust to hold its shape during baking. When combined with butter and sugar, it creates a tender, crumbly texture that complements the tart filling beautifully.
2. Granulated Sugar: The addition of granulated sugar is essential for adding sweetness to the crust. It not only enhances the flavor but also contributes to the crust’s delicate texture. The sugar caramelizes slightly during baking, giving the crust a golden color and a slight crunch.
3. Unsalted Butter: Unsalted butter is key to achieving the rich flavor and tender texture of the crust. It helps bind the flour and sugar together while providing a creamy taste that elevates the overall flavor profile of the bars. Using unsalted butter allows you to control the sodium content of the recipe, ensuring a balanced taste.
4. Salt: While it may seem counterintuitive to add salt to a sweet recipe, a pinch of salt is crucial for enhancing the overall flavors. Salt helps to intensify the sweetness of the sugar and balances the tartness of the filling, resulting in a more complex and satisfying flavor.
The Filling Ingredients
The filling of the Zesty Blueberry Lemon Dream Bars is where the magic happens. Here’s a closer look at the key ingredients that bring this dessert to life:
1. Eggs: Eggs serve as a binding agent in the filling, providing structure and stability. They help to create a custard-like consistency that holds together the blueberries and lemon juice. The proteins in eggs coagulate during baking, ensuring that the filling sets properly.
2. Granulated Sugar: Similar to its role in the crust, granulated sugar in the filling balances the tartness of the lemon juice. The sugar dissolves and creates a sweet syrup that envelopes the blueberries, enhancing their natural flavor.
3. Additional Flour: A small amount of flour is added to the filling to provide structure and prevent it from becoming too runny. This helps the filling hold together and ensures the bars maintain their shape after baking.
4. Freshly Squeezed Lemon Juice: The use of freshly squeezed lemon juice is vital for achieving the best flavor in your Zesty Blueberry Lemon Dream Bars. Fresh juice has a vibrant, zesty flavor that is far superior to bottled lemon juice, which may contain preservatives or additives that dull the natural citrus brightness.
5. Lemon Zest: Lemon zest adds an extra layer of flavor intensity to the filling. The zest contains essential oils from the lemon peel, providing a fragrant, aromatic quality that enhances the overall taste of the bars.
6. Blueberries: The star of the show! You can choose between fresh or frozen blueberries for this recipe. Fresh blueberries tend to provide a better texture and flavor, as they burst beautifully during baking. However, if fresh blueberries are out of season, frozen ones can work well too. Just be sure to thaw and drain them before incorporating them into the filling to prevent excess moisture.
Step-by-Step Preparation
Now that we’ve explored the ingredients in detail, it’s time to dive into the preparation of these delicious bars. Follow these steps to ensure your Zesty Blueberry Lemon Dream Bars come out perfectly every time.
Preparing the Crust
1. Preheat the Oven: Begin by preheating your oven to 350°F (175°C). This step is crucial, as it ensures that your bars bake evenly and develop a lovely golden crust.
2. Choose the Right Baking Dish: For this recipe, a 9×9-inch or 8×8-inch square baking dish is ideal. Make sure to line the dish with parchment paper, leaving some overhang on the sides. This will make it easier to lift the bars out of the dish once they’re baked and cooled.
3. Mix the Crust Ingredients: In a medium-sized mixing bowl, combine the all-purpose flour, granulated sugar, and salt. Whisk them together until well blended. Next, melt the unsalted butter and allow it to cool slightly before pouring it into the dry ingredients.
4. Combine and Form the Crust: Use a fork or your fingertips to combine the melted butter with the dry mixture until it resembles coarse crumbs. The mixture should hold together when pressed into the bottom of the prepared baking dish.
5. Press the Crust into the Dish: Pour the crust mixture into the lined baking dish and press it down firmly with the back of a measuring cup or your hands to create an even layer. Make sure the crust is tightly packed, as this will prevent it from crumbling once baked.
6. Bake the Crust: Place the baking dish in the preheated oven and bake for about 15-20 minutes, or until the edges are lightly golden. Keep an eye on it to avoid over-baking, as a perfect crust should be tender yet firm enough to hold the filling.
Preparing the Filling
With the crust baking in the oven, it’s time to prepare the zesty filling that will crown these delightful bars.
1. Whisk the Eggs: In a large mixing bowl, crack the eggs and whisk them until they are well combined. The eggs should be slightly frothy, indicating that they are aerated, which will help the filling rise slightly while baking.
2. Add Sugar and Flour: Gradually add the granulated sugar and the additional flour to the whisked eggs. Stir until the mixture is smooth and well combined. This step is important for ensuring that there are no lumps in your filling.
3. Incorporate Lemon Juice and Zest: Next, add the freshly squeezed lemon juice and lemon zest to the egg mixture. Stir well to combine, allowing the bright flavors to meld together.
4. Fold in the Blueberries: Finally, gently fold in your chosen blueberries, ensuring they are evenly distributed throughout the filling. Be careful not to overmix, as this can break the berries and create a mushy texture.
Once your filling is ready and the crust has finished baking, you will be set to complete the assembly of these delicious bars.

Tips for Achieving the Perfect Crust Texture
Creating the ideal crust for your Zesty Blueberry Lemon Dream Bars is crucial for the overall texture and taste. A good crust should be buttery, slightly crisp, and provide a sturdy base to hold the luscious filling. Here are some tips to help you achieve this perfect crust:
1. Use Cold Ingredients: Ensure your butter is cold and cubed before mixing. This helps create a flaky texture as the butter melts during baking, releasing steam and creating air pockets.
2. Do Not Overmix: When combining the flour, sugar, and butter, mix just until the ingredients are incorporated. Overmixing can lead to a tough crust. Aim for a crumbly texture that holds together when pressed.
3. Chill the Dough: After preparing the crust mixture, press it into the baking dish and refrigerate it for at least 30 minutes. Chilling helps solidify the butter, leading to a more tender and flaky crust once baked.
Crafting the Filling
The filling is the star of these bars, balancing the tartness of the lemon with the sweetness of the blueberries. To craft this delightful filling, follow these steps meticulously:
1. Whisking Technique for Eggs and Sugar: In a large mixing bowl, begin by whisking the eggs and sugar together until the mixture is pale and slightly thickened. This incorporates air, which is essential for a light and fluffy filling. A hand whisk or an electric mixer can be used; just ensure you reach a smooth consistency.
2. Incorporating Lemon Juice and Zest Smoothly: Once your egg and sugar mixture is ready, slowly add in the freshly squeezed lemon juice and lemon zest. To avoid any clumps, whisk continuously while pouring in the lemon juice. This ensures the flavors meld beautifully without any separation.
3. Techniques for Folding in Blueberries Without Damaging Them: Gently fold in the blueberries using a spatula. Start by adding a small amount of the filling to the blueberries to coat them, and then gently combine them into the rest of the mixture. This prevents smashing the berries while ensuring they’re evenly distributed.
Combining and Baking
Now that your crust and filling are prepared, it’s time to combine and bake:
1. Pouring the Filling Over the Hot Crust: After the crust has baked for about 15 minutes and is slightly golden, carefully pour the lemon filling over the hot crust. This step is crucial; the heat helps set the filling and enhances the flavors.
2. Signs of Doneness for the Filling: Bake the bars for an additional 25-30 minutes, or until the filling is set but still has a slight jiggle in the center. The edges should be lightly golden, and a toothpick inserted into the filling should come out clean. Keep a close watch to avoid overbaking, which can lead to a dry filling.
Cooling and Serving Suggestions
After baking, cooling is vital for the best flavor and texture:
1. The Significance of Cooling and Refrigeration for Flavor Development: Allow the bars to cool in the pan at room temperature for about 30-45 minutes. Then, transfer them to the refrigerator to chill for at least 2 hours, or overnight if possible. This cooling period allows the flavors to deepen and the filling to firm up, making it easier to cut.
2. Best Practices for Cutting and Serving the Bars: When ready to serve, use a sharp knife that has been warmed under hot water to cut through the bars cleanly. Wipe the knife between cuts for neat slices. Serve them chilled for the best experience, perhaps with a light dusting of powdered sugar on top for presentation.

Storage and Shelf Life
To maintain the freshness of your Zesty Blueberry Lemon Dream Bars, consider the following:
1. Optimal Storage Conditions for Maintaining Freshness: Store the bars in an airtight container in the refrigerator. This helps retain their moisture and flavor. If you wish to stack them, place parchment paper between layers to prevent sticking.
2. How Long the Bars Can Be Stored and Best Practices for Freezing: Under proper refrigeration, the bars can last up to one week. For longer storage, freeze them. Wrap each bar individually in plastic wrap and then place them in a freezer-safe container. They can be stored frozen for up to 3 months. To enjoy, simply thaw them in the refrigerator overnight.
